The Great Northern Railway Depot Clocktower is a historic landmark located in Spokane, Washington, in the United States of America. Built in 1902, it is a prominent feature of the city's skyline and a symbol of its rich railroad heritage. The clocktower stands at the former site of the Great Northern Railway Depot, which played a significant role in Spokane's development as a transportation hub during the early 20th century.
